Job description

Purpose

The Advanced Application Specialist plays a crucial role in managing customer issues, collaborating with product teams to develop new features, and serving as the voice of the customer within the company. Responsibilities include offering clinical support, gathering feedback from existing users, and ensuring customer satisfaction by working closely with various teams within the company. This role provides advanced application training, assists with product configurations, makes workflow recommendations, and resolves challenging product issues in a timely and efficient manner. In-depth knowledge of Cancer Risk Assessment and program management is essential in working with the Product Team to refine product offerings and ensure that they meet the needs of Volpara’s customers.


Responsibilities

  • Subject Matter Expertise: Serve as a subject matter expert for both internal staff as well as customers. Collaborate to create various training materials, support marketing initiatives, develop case studies, and product demonstration strategies that will work to align best practices with Volpara’s current product, adapting as the products evolve.
  • Clinical Workflow Resource: Assist the Product Team in understanding clinical workflows and in building a library of workflows for product testing. Support customers post launch with consultative guidance if a change or optimization of process is needed.
  • Participate in Conferences and Events: Support trade shows and professional conferences by conducting product demonstrations, customer trainings, and delivering clinical presentations. In addition, lead quarterly user group meetings providing customers with opportunities to learn best practices, exchange tips and tricks, and connect with other end users to optimize their experience with the products.
  • Maintain Market Knowledge: Stay updated with the latest advancements and enhancements in the field and possess an in-depth understanding of various competitive offerings and their advantages and disadvantages over Volpara.
  • Advocate for Customer Needs: As a liaison between customers and product teams, provide clinical input and feedback to prioritize new technology developments and incorporate customer requirements into the product roadmap. Serve as the 'voice of the customer' by advocating for their needs and providing internal feedback on how to maximize customer value and retention. Work closely with Product and Engineering teams to drive product development for new integrations and features and participate in new and upgrade product release testing to ensure customer satisfaction. Keep management informed of any concerns that may impact the ability to effectively sell and support products in the channel.
  • Manage Strategic Customer Relationships: Manage relationships with Key Opinion Leaders (KOLs) and customer advocates and support Early Adopters during beta testing and product evaluation projects.
  • Customer Issue Management: Provide clinical assistance and troubleshooting expertise to address problems and ensure customer satisfaction. Evaluate data discrepancies and concerns communicating findings to customers.

Experience & Qualifications

  • Certifications: Bachelor's degree preferred in related business or technical/clinical field. Professional clinical/technical certifications/registries (such as ARRT, ARDMS, RN, BSN, BHCN, CGRA ) preferred. Minimum of 5 years clinical/ technical experience following certification with demonstrated clinical/technical skills preferred.
  • Knowledge of Cancer Risk Assessment models and management guidelines.
  • Strong understanding of high-risk clinical management pathways.
  • Experience with interdisciplinary and cross-facility relationships between primary care physicians, surgeons, genetic counselors, and other health care providers involved in Risk Assessment programs.
  • Cancer genetics and oncology knowledge.
  • Problem-solving Skills: Ability to analyze and troubleshoot complex technical issues related to mammography reporting software. Strong problem-solving skills and attention to detail are crucial for efficient issue resolution.
  • Communication Skills: Excellent verbal and written communication skills are essential to effectively manage customer issues, collaborate with product teams, and deliver training sessions. Ability to convey complex technical concepts in a clear and concise manner is required.
  • Customer-oriented Approach: Proven track record of providing exceptional customer service and support. Ability to empathize with customers, understand their needs, and deliver solutions that meet or exceed their expectations.
  • Team Player: Ability to work collaboratively within a cross-functional team environment. Strong interpersonal skills and the ability to build positive relationships with colleagues, customers, and stakeholders.
  • Customer-centric mindset with a drive for understanding customer needs. Collaborative approach partnering with the commercial, implementation, operation, support, and product teams for clinical success.
  • Goal-oriented mindset combined with resilience in the face of setbacks.
  • Strong interpersonal skills to engage with various stakeholders.
  • Effective educator, capable of training demanding customers.
  • Proof of COVID 19 vaccination required, except in limited circumstances where a legally recognized medical or religious exemption may be able to be accommodated.
  • Must be willing to travel up to twenty five percent (25%) of the time. Position is remote.
